Northern Pass Transmission Project Receiving Opposition

An announcement has come from The Northern Pass transmission line project stating they will bury 52 miles of lines in the North Country. According to the Northern Pass website, the route also shortens some towers by decreasing the total amount of electricity from 1,200 megawatts to 1,000 megawatts.

The Northern pass project also states it is dedicated to supporting North country opportunities, supports tourism initiatives, and community investment. The Appalachian Mountain Club remains firmly opposed to the 186-mile transmission line stating it  will visually impact the White Mountain National Forest, Appalachian Trail, and over 95,000 acres throughout the state.

The AMC continues to work in opposition to the project as proposed and is working with partners to raise concern about its visual, environmental, and economic impacts.
